Daman and Diu Tenders - Statistics
The total number of published tenders on Daman and Diu Tenders portal from 2015 to till date is 4,425 with worth ₹15,704 crores. These tenders received 7,650 bids from 1,970 bidders, with participation from 62 organizations. The process is managed efficiently by 204 department users on eProc Portal.
A total of 744 tenders were published in FY 2023-24 with a combined value of ₹2,366 crores. These tenders received 1,395 bids across sectors on Diu tenders. The portal recorded 628 tenders with value of ₹1,155 crores in FY 2024 -25. There are 988 bids submitted during this period.
There are 422 tenders that have been published with a value of ₹3,546.07 crores in FY 2025-26 till now. These tenders have attracted 693 bidders till now.

Diu Tenders - Registration Process
The registration process makes the vendors eligible to participate in the DD Tenders opportunities. It is mandatory for the vendors to register on the eProc Daman and Diu tenders Portal. The registration process for Daman Tender is mentioned below:
- Visit Website - Visit the eProc Portal and go to the Online Bidder Enrollment Section.
- Login - Create the login id and password, once these are created it can not be changed.
-
Company details - Enter the company information.
- Company Name, Registration Number, Establishment Year, Address.
- Name of Partners / Directors, Bidder Type, Nature of Business, Address.
- Legal Status, Company Category, Pan Details.
-
Contact Details - Enter the Company's or Contact Person Details.
- Contact Name, Date Of Birth, Designation, and Contact number.
- Pre registration details - Enter the details for Bidder Pre Registered with, Organisation Type, Udyog Aadhaar Number, Bidder Registered Type
-
Documents Upload - The Vendor should upload the required documents in the
prescribed format.
- Technical and Financial Documents - Partnership Deed, MOA, AOA, GST Certificate, PAN Card, Aadhaar ID, ITR, and Turnover Certificate, Bank Certificate.
- MSMEs Details - Enter the MSMEs details and provide the MSME / Udyam Registration Certificate to register on DD Tenders Portal.
- Final Submission - Review the details and submit the application. The vendor will receive the Login id and password on the registered email.
- DSC Setup - DSC registration is mandatory in the eTender activities on Daman Tender portal. The vendors have to register the Class 3 DSC at least 24 hours before the bid any tenders.

Daman Tender - Search and Bidding Process
The vendors have to find the right tender before starting the bidding process. The vendor can search the tenders on the Daman and Diu Tenders Portal matching their requirements and participate online.
- Search Tenders - Find the relevant tenders from expertise by using filters - Tender ID, My Product Categories, Tender Number.
- Save as Favourite - The DD Tenders can be added to the favourite list for future use. The detailed information and documents are in the Tenders details page.
- Terms and Conditions - Review the tenders eligibility as mentioned in the document and accept the terms.
- User Details - Verify the user details that are mentioned at the time of registration on Diu tenders portal.
- EMD Exemption - Apply for the Tender fee and EMD exemption of the vendor belongin to the exempted categories.
-
Documents - Upload the required documents as mentioned in the tenders guidelines.
- PoA, project proposals and experience certificates.
- BOQ, declarations, affidavits, pre-qualification, technical, and financial documents.
- Submission - Submit and save the acknowledgement for the further reference.
- Withdraw Bid: The vendors can give reason for withdrawal and upload supporting documents; an acknowledgment is generated after submission.
- Resubmit Bid: Edit and resubmit Tender Fee, EMD, or bid documents as needed; the portal generates a resubmission acknowledgment.
- Tender Status - The bidder can check the DD Tenders results under evaluation tab on the Daman Tender.
